=== Life Sketch ===
Came into Britain with William the Conqueror
John de Walbieffe, a Norman, came to Britain with William the Conqueror and supported the campaign against Bleddyn. In return, de Walbeiffe was given the manors of Llanhamlach and Llanfihangel Tal y Llyn.
